Fort Rein

A fortress in Aargau connected to Switzerland’s secret Cold War resistance network P-26, now open as a museum.

Null Stern Hotel

A former nuclear bunker turned into a zero-star hotel concept and art installation — where the only star is you.

Oberalppass Complex

An entire mountaintop under Swiss military control, accessible by cable car and containing a classified bunker complex.

Zivilschutz-Museum Zürich

The City of Zurich’s civil defence museum, documenting the history of Swiss civilian protection from the Cold War to the present.

Urania Underground

A seven-storey underground space beneath Zurich’s Old Town that doubles as a parking garage — featured by the Washington Post.

Sonnenberg Bunker

The former world’s largest civilian nuclear fallout shelter, built beneath the A2 motorway in Lucerne. Designed for 20,000 people, now a Cold War museum.

Villa Rose

A seemingly quaint villa in Fribourg that hides a secret military bunker beneath its walls — a classic example of Swiss military camouflage.
